Mid-range-low-power Laptop processor released in 2012 with 2 cores and 4 threads. With base clock at 2.6GHz, max speed at 2.6GHz, and a 17W power rating. Core i5-3317U is based on the Ivy Bridge 22nm family and part of the Core i5 series.
